A light and uncertain hold

The outer archives are busy

by David T. Thackery

About this book

Not only a military history, A Light and Uncertain Hold is also a penetrating and provocative social history which deals with the homefront, morale, reenlistment, and the memory and commemoration of the Civil War. The words and stories of individual soldiers give depth and substance to the regiment's experience. The great dividing line - the most important catalyst in the creation of regimental pride and identification - was the introduction to combat. In the case of the Sixty-sixth, its first combat experience was Port Republic. This set these soldiers apart from the civilian world whose structures and protections were no longer relevant. The new veterans were now divorced from the security of their civilian lives and could rely only on one another in matters which were truly life and death.
